Champion, Cheryl Stubbendieck, is retiring as volunteer Executive Director of Barnabas Community
Since Barnabas Community first began in 2008, Cheryl Stubbendieck has been a consistent volunteer who has given countless hours in service to this ministry. Cheryl, working with others from Sheridan, helped to manage the start up of the store. Once Barnabas outgrew the initial facility, the team found the current location at 931 Saunders Ave. Cheryl again was instrumental in facilitating that move and starting the ministry of the community center. For the past three years, Cheryl has volunteered countless hours to Barnabas as the volunteer Executive Director. This spring, Cheryl retires from this work. Barnabas Community would not be what it is without Cheryl’s efforts and service. We are indebted to her and our hearts are thankful! Volunteers make Barnabas thrive!
Did you know that in 2015, Barnabas served 1,200 families? The only way that was possible was due to our Barnabas volunteers! As of February 2016, we already have more than 400 families registered. Barnabas volunteers make this ministry happen by serving in a multitude of roles. Volunteers donate clothing and household goods, drive donations to Barnabas, sort donations, host guests in the community center, work in the store and pray for the ministry. Our volunteers give hundreds of hours each month to ensure that Barnabas is consistently available to our guests.
Each week, Barnabas provides clothing, household goods, and a place to be in the community center. Our ministry to the hungry grew significantly this past year. On Saturdays, we provide delicious breakfast foods to 60-80 guests. The final Thursday of the month, we serve a free buffet dinner, serving 60+ guests. Each Sunday, Foodnet at Barnabas provides fresh produce, dairy and food items to 135 families. This partnership is a win-win because it diverts food away from the landfill and into the hands of those who are hungry.
